### Action Item: Spoolhaven Retry Storm

From last Tuesday's outage: the Spoolhaven print service retried failed jobs without backoff, saturating the render pool. Fix merged; retries now use capped exponential backoff with jitter. Owner will monitor for a week before closing. The agreed retry constants are recorded below.

constants for yadup-kajof:
RATE_LIMITS = {
    "zorwyn": 1,
    "druwyn": 1,
}

# Onboarding: GPU Memory Profiling at Vextrel Labs

The profiling stack for the Quillgrid renderer lives in the `memtrace` repo. It samples allocator events on each Halcyon-class GPU node and ships flamegraphs to the Opalboard dashboard. Future maintainers should rebuild the capture agent whenever the driver ABI changes; the CI job flags mismatches but does not block merges. The encrypted profiler archive on the Tarn cluster requires the standing recovery passphrase, which is recorded immediately below this paragraph.

vault phrase of bagaf-kajeg = jorath-feniel-briir-siliel-ralix

**Action item: PRT-114 (owner: on-call)**

The spooler service at Quillhaven dropped jobs during the Tuesday backlog spike because retry intervals were hardcoded and queue depth limits were never tuned after the Marlowe migration. Fix: externalize the constants into the spooler config map, add alerting when depth exceeds 80% of cap, and verify drain behavior in staging before Friday. Do not restart the service mid-drain. Apply the following tuning constants exactly as listed below.

tuning constants:
QUOTAS = {
    "druwyn": 5,
    "holix": 5,
    "zorath": 5,
    "holwyn": 10,
}

**Mgmt Meeting Minutes — Retiring the Brightline Range**

Quick recap for sales leads at Fenholt Supplies: we agreed to retire the Brightline fixture range by year-end. Remaining stock moves to clearance pricing next month, and accounts on standing orders get migrated to the Lumetta range. Trade-in incentives were approved in principle. The confidential note on next steps sits just below.

board note of bajof-bajeg: The pricing group signed off on a budget of $13.4 million for Project Sildor. The renewal with Lamixek Holdings closes at $48.9 million a year, 49 percent above the last contract.